A Quickie with Lynam's Dee Dee

Cristy: Right...okay well, we have these little things, they’re called Quickies. They’re like these five questions we ask everybody. You ready for this?
Dee Dee: (snorts) Yeah.

    Cristy: What's your definition of 'happiness'?
  • Dee Dee: Um, a six pack.

    Cristy: What’s your guilty pleasure?
  • Dee Dee: Ooohh, I don’t have a guilty pleasure. I don’t think..
    Cristy: Everybody does.
    Dee Dee: My jeep. My jeep is my guilty pleasure.
    Cristy: Is it like Jeep Jeep?
    Dee Dee: Yeah a Jeep Jeep, yeah. It’s an 84 CK7.
    (Cristy’s note: I’m not sure which is scarier, that I said “jeep jeep” or that he knew what I meant!)

    Cristy: Who would play you in the movie version of your life?
  • Dee Dee: That guy who plays Kelso in "That 70's Show."
    Cristy: Ashton Kutcher.
    Dee Dee: Yeah he’d play me. He’d have to dye his hair though.

    Cristy: Tell me about your first kiss.
  • Dee Dee: Well, I just walked on the bus 30 minutes ago and Jacob kissed me, so that was my first kiss.
    Cristy: I kinda find that hard to believe.
    Dee Dee: From a guy or a girl?
    Cristy: In general.
    Dee Dee: Oh! Well that was my first kiss from a guy....um....my first kiss, you know I really don’t remember it. I think I was like six or seven, it was my sister.
    Cristy: Such a smart ass.
    (major vocal grief in the background)
    Dee Dee: I’m six or seven, that’s my answer, I’m sticking to it.
